Explanation:

Run-on sentences are sentences that consist of two or more independent clauses that are connected incorrectly. A common example of a run-on sentence is a comma splice, which occurs when independent clauses are connected just by a comma.

Run-on sentences can be corrected by adding a:

  • semicolon
  • comma followed by a subordinate conjunction
  • comma followed by a coordinating conjunction

Run-on sentences can also be corrected by dividing the independent clauses into separate sentences.
